About Ackley, IA

Ackley is a small community in Iowa with a population of 1,554 residents. The median household income is $61,667 per year, which is near the national average. The median age in Ackley is 41.7 years.

Housing in Ackley has a median home value of $99,200 and median monthly rent of $677. Of the 752 total housing units, the majority are owner-occupied, with 547 owner-occupied and 105 renter-occupied units.

The unemployment rate in Ackley is 1.9% and the poverty rate is 10.8%. 21.6%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 22.6 minutes.

Cost of Living in Ackley, IA

Compared to national averages, Ackley has a median household income of $61,667 (18% below the national median of $75,149). Home values average $99,200, which is 59% below the national median. Monthly rent at $677 is 42% below the US average of $1,163. Within Iowa, Ackley's income is 9% below the state average of $67,947, and home values are 25% below the state median of $132,237.
